Odyssey: The Disco and Soul Pioneers

Odyssey is an American vocal group best known for their smooth blend of disco, funk, and soul. Hailing from New York City, the group achieved international fame in the late 1970s and early 1980s with their timeless dance floor anthems.

Early Career

Originally formed as the Lopez Sisters by siblings Lillian, Louise, and Carmen Lopez, the group's early sound was rooted in soul. After Carmen's departure, the remaining sisters rebranded as Odyssey and were joined by lead singer Tony Reynolds, solidifying the trio that would find commercial success.

Breakthrough

The group's major breakthrough came in 1977 with the release of their self-titled debut album on RCA Records. The album's lead single became a global phenomenon, propelling Odyssey to the top of charts worldwide and establishing them as leading figures in the disco era.

Key Tracks

Native New Yorker - This 1977 single became their signature hit, reaching the Top 10 on the Billboard Hot 100 and achieving platinum status.

Inside Out - A follow-up success that further cemented their place in disco history with its infectious groove.

Going Back to My Roots - A 1981 cover that became a massive club hit, showcasing their ability to reinvent classic soul tracks for the dance floor.

Use It Up and Wear It Out - This 1980 track topped the UK Singles Chart, demonstrating their lasting international appeal beyond the initial disco wave.

The group continued to record and perform through various lineup changes over the decades, with original member Lillian Lopez often at the helm. Their music has endured, sampled by modern producers and featured in numerous films and television shows, highlighting the timeless quality of their disco and soul fusion.
